Presidential task-force retrieved over 20 government vehicles from Maryland County

Monrovia-Over Twenty One government vehicles have been retrieved from the South East in Maryland County by the Special Presidential Task-force.

Speaking with OK News late Wednesday evening, the head of the Task-force, Benedict Reeves said the retrieval was made possible following tape-off from residents of Harper City.

He said the Task Force has also recommended for prosecution, the GSA Coordinator in Harper Maryland County Adophus William for allegedly selling government vehicles.

He however pointed accusing fingers to Madam Mary Broh for her alleged interference in the operation of the Task Force, adding that the GSA Boss action is undermining the President Mandate; something he said does not augur well for the country.

Mr. Reeves noted that his team will continue its operation in Montserrado and its environs to ensure that all stolen vehicles are retrieved in keeping with Presidential mandate.

Meanwhile, the GSA Director General has refused to comment on the allegation made the head of the Presidential Taskforce.
